Role Description We are seeking a dynamic and customer-focused Product Manager to drive the vision, discovery, and delivery of high-impact SaaS products. In this role, you will deeply understand our customers, market, and business to consistently deliver meaningful value. You will partner closely with UX and Engineering in a highly collaborative, Agile environment, owning the product lifecycle from early discovery through delivery, outcomes, and go-to-market execution. This role is ideal for a product leader who thrives in fast-paced environments, values autonomy, and brings strong problem-solving, facilitation, and communication skills to cross-functional teams. - Develop deep knowledge of customers, market dynamics, and product usage to inform product strategy and decision-making. - Own and be accountable for the full product lifecycle, including new product evaluation, discovery, delivery, measurement of outcomes, and go-to-market programs. - Apply both creative and analytical approaches to product challenges, incorporating user insights, data, and cross-functional input to shape solutions. - Define, manage, and execute against a prioritized product roadmap aligned with company goals and business outcomes. - Partner closely with Product Design and Engineering to define product vision, epics, and critical capabilities, ensuring alignment in an Agile development environment. - Ensure user stories and requirements clearly align to strategic product objectives and deliver measurable customer value. - Collaborate with Product Marketing to develop differentiated value propositions, positioning, and messaging, and to support go-to-market planning and execution. - Build and maintain strong working relationships with design, engineering, product marketing, sales, customer success, strategic partners, and customers. - Continuously evaluate product performance using qualitative and quantitative metrics to inform iteration and future investment. Qualifications - 2+ years of experience successfully delivering SaaS products in a Product Management role. - Proven experience working in Agile development environments with continuous delivery or deployment practices. - Demonstrated competency in modern product discovery techniques, including user research, experimentation, and iterative validation. - Strong passion for product design and user-centered design thinking. - Solid financial acumen, with the ability to interpret key financial indicators and apply insights to product and business decisions. - Ability to approach complex problems with a global and systems-level perspective. - Excellent communication, facilitation, and collaboration skills across technical and non-technical stakeholders. -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Business, or a related field, or equivalent experience. - Willingness to travel up to 25% as required.
